DTC P2199-00: IAT Sensor No.2 Circuit Range/Performance Problem: Notes

DETECTION CONDITION AND POSSIBLE CAUSE

DTC P2199:00 IAT sensor No.2 circuit range/performance problem
DETECTION CONDITION 
  • IAT sensor No.1, IAT sensor No.2 and ECT sensor No.1 are compared after the engine is started and correlation error occurs.

    *: Ignition switch on when 6 h or more has passed since the ignition was switched to off.


Diagnostic support note 
  • This is a continuous monitor (CCM).
  • The check engine light illuminates if the PCM detects the above malfunction condition in two consecutive drive cycles or in one drive cycle while the DTC for the same malfunction has been stored in the PCM.
  • PENDING CODE is available if the PCM detects the above malfunction condition during first drive cycle.
  • FREEZE FRAME DATA (Mode 2)/Snapshot data is available.
  • The DTC is stored in the PCM memory.
FAIL-SAFE FUNCTION  -
POSSIBLE CAUSE 
  • MAF sensor/IAT sensor No.1 connector or terminals malfunction
  • MAP sensor/IAT sensor No.2 connector or terminals malfunction
  • IAT sensor No.1 malfunction
  • IAT sensor No.2 malfunction
  • PCM connector or terminals malfunction
  • ECT sensor No.1 malfunction
  • PCM malfunction
